Chinese telcos will be spending about $41 billion in 3G technology in the coming next two years. According to the minister of Industry and Information Technology Li Yizhong, China will support the development of core microchips, terminals and testing equipment as it expands network coverage. 3G spending in 2009 is projected at $29.2 billion, with the coming of licence awards.
